Prada, Men’s & Women’s show, Fall/Winter 2015/16, Milan

In terms of clothing, black is the star color for next winter. Deep black for monochromatic, long silhouettes composed of double-breasted suits and a multitude of overcoats. Pants are worn fitted on the leg. Even in winter, men go out in shirts. The fantasy is more in the shoes, with a notched-soled sneaker. Women also take to the catwalk, dressed in dark colors, such as high-waisted dresses with open backs, flared skirts and ornamental bows. It’s hard to see the details of this tone-on-tone collection, but you can make out a few rectangular strips of fabric creating graphic effects on the garment. The only touch of softness and color is a large women’s coat, belted in soft red tartan. Here again, it’s all a question of details and materials for a rather consensual wardrobe, with reinterpreted basics. Note the stylish effect of slightly rolled-up sleeves on jackets and coats, revealing the linings.
